Functional Description ? help Back to Top
Source Description
UniProtTranscription activator that coordinates abscisic acid (ABA) biosynthesis and signaling-related genes via binding to the specific promoter motif 5'-(A/T)AACCAT-3'. Represses ABA-mediated salt (e.g. NaCl and KCl) stress tolerance. Regulates leaf shape and promotes vegetative growth. {ECO:0000269|PubMed:26243618}.

Regulation -- Description ? help Back to Top
Source Description
UniProtINDUCTION: Induced by salicylic acid (SA) and gibberellic acid (GA) (PubMed:16463103). Triggered by dehydration and salt stress (PubMed:26243618). {ECO:0000269|PubMed:16463103, ECO:0000269|PubMed:26243618}.
